zl程序教程

您现在的位置是:首页 >  数据库

当前栏目

美团Java面试题,mysql使用教程5.5

2023-09-27 14:22:52 时间

Kafka源码篇——Kafka快速入门

1.1Kafka简介

1.2以Kafka为中心的解决方案

1.3 Kafka核心概念

1.4搭建Kafka源码环境

Kafka源码篇——生产者

2.1 KafkaProducer使用示例

2.2 KafkaProducer分析

2.3 RecordAccumulator分析

2.4 Sender分析

Kafka源码篇——消费者

3.1 KafkaConsumer使用示例

3.2传递保证语义(Delivery guarantee semantic )

3.3 Consumer Group Rebalance设计

3.4 KafkaConsumer 分析

Kafka源码篇——Kafka服务端

4.1网络层

4.2API层

4.3日志存储

4.4 DelayedOperationPurgatory组件

4.5副本机制

4.6 KafkaController

4.7 GroupCoordinator

4.8身份认证与权限控制

4.9Kafka监控

Kafka源码篇——Kafka Tool

5.1 kafka-server-start脚本

5.2kafka-topics脚本

5.3 kafka-preferred-replica-election脚本

5.4 kafka-reassign-partitions脚本

5.5 kafka-console-producer 脚本

5.6 kafka-console-consumer 脚本

5.7 kafka-consumer-groups脚本

5.8 DumpLogSegments

5.9 kafka-producer-perf-test 脚本

5.10 kafka-consumer-perf-test脚本

5.11 kafka-mirror-maker脚本

Kafka的设计与实现

讨论一:Kafka 存储在文件系统上

讨论二:Kafka 中的底层存储设计

讨论三:生产者设计概要

讨论四:消费者设计概要

讨论五:Kafka 如何保证可靠性

最后

笔者已经把面试题和答案整理成了面试专题文档,有想获取到借鉴参考的朋友:点赞关注后,戳这里即可免费领取

image

image

image

image

image

链图片转存中…(img-MxNJiRvG-1625153354943)]

[外链图片转存中…(img-M8ralaqr-1625153354944)]

[外链图片转存中…(img-RiOJlAJX-1625153354945)]

[外链图片转存中…(img-eGXQdUlZ-1625153354946)]

image